Fukui temperatures in August

Fukui is a region in Japan. August is generally a very warm month with maximum daytime temperatures around 30°C and nighttime temperatures around 24°C in Tsuruga. August is a summer month. On average, August is the warmest month of the year in Fukui. So be prepared and pack summer clothes.

  • How much sun does Fukui get in August?
  • The city Tsuruga usually sees around 208 hours of sunlight, indicating many sunny days.
